VALENTINE, Neb. – The South Dakota State men's golf team finished in third place at the Prairie Club Invitational hosted by SDSU and Nebraska on the par-73, 7,369-yard Dunes Course at The Prairie Club on Monday.
Â
The Jackrabbits concluded the event with 297-289-308—894 (+18). Missouri captured first at 871 (-5), while a total score of 891 (+15) put Sam Houston State in second place.
Â
Harry Duggan placed among the top five as he finished tied for fourth with 72-70-76—218 (-1). Duggan recorded birdies on holes 5, 11, 13 and 15 as he fired a third-round score of 76 (+3).

Jack Tanner completed the event in 16
th place after carding an 80 (+7) in the final 18 holes, for a three-round total of 226 (+7).

Tying for 17
th was
Jacob Otta, 75-73-79—227 (+8), and
Jones Comerford, who shot even par in the final round for a 54-hole total of 227 (+8).
Matthew Schaefer finished tied for 37
th with
Noah Boraas, who competed as an individual, with 235 (+16).

Jonah Dohrer also competed individually and tied with Comerford on the day with the best final round score for the Jacks at 73 (E). Dohrer finished the Prairie Club Invitational tied for 26
th with 230 (+11).
